servings

英 [ˈsɜːvɪŋz]

美 [ˈsɜrvɪŋz]

n.  (供一个人吃的)一份食物
serving的复数

柯林斯词典

  • N-COUNT (供一个人吃的)一份食物的量
    Aservingis an amount of food that is given to one person at a meal.
    1. Quantities will vary according to how many servings of soup you want to prepare...
      量的多少根据你想准备的汤的份数而定。
    2. Each serving contains 240 calories.
      每份食物含 240 卡热量。
  • ADJ (勺子、盘子)分菜用的,上菜用的
    Aservingspoon or dish is used for giving out food at a meal.
    1. Pile the potatoes into a warm serving dish.
      将土豆堆在一个保温菜盘里。
